Master of Science in Biological Sciences

The Master of Science in Biological Sciences is a postgraduate programme that prepares professionals for advanced practice in biological research, ecology, and organismal biology. The programme combines biological theory with practical field and laboratory research application.

Core areas include cell biology, genetics, ecology, entomology, plant biology, animal biology, microbiology, evolution, biostatistics, research methods, and thesis. Students engage with both biological theory and practical research through coursework, fieldwork, and laboratory work.

The programme is offered by the University of Nairobi through the Department of Biology. It is a public university offering the programme over two academic years through full-time and part-time modes of study.

Students develop competencies in cell biology, genetics, ecology, entomology, plant biology, animal biology, microbiology, evolution, biostatistics, and research methods. The programme includes coursework, examinations, fieldwork, and a research thesis with specialisation options in entomology or other biological disciplines.

UoN charges approximately KES 365,500/year (KES 731,000 total) including tuition, examination, and statutory charges. Entry requires a Bachelor's degree with Second Class Honours Upper Division in biological sciences, botany, zoology, or related fields from a recognised university.

Graduates pursue careers as biologists, research scientists, ecologists, entomologists, conservation scientists, and lecturers in biological sciences across research institutions, environmental organisations, government agencies, and universities.

Getting in

The grades, the alternatives, and who accredits the award.

What you need

KCSE mean grade
N/A (Postgraduate)
Alternative entry
Most universities require Upper Second Class Honours in biological sciences, botany, zoology, or related fields. Lower Second Division holders with evidence of research ability may be considered. Contact respective universities for specific admission requirements.
